In a significant step towards strengthening Nigeria’s economic fundamentals, the Minister of Finance and Coordinating Minister of the Economy, Wale Edun, on Tuesday, held a strategic meeting with the Governor of the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N), Dr. Olayemi Cardoso, at the CBN Headquarters in Abuja.

The Chairman of the Federal Inland Revenue Service (FIRS), Dr. Zacch Adedeji, was also in attendance.

The high-level engagement focused on deepening coordination between monetary and fiscal authorities to sustain macroeconomic stability, strengthen investor confidence, and unlock private sector growth.

The Minister reaffirmed that close alignment between fiscal and monetary policy is critical to consolidating President Bola Tinubu’s reform agenda, ensuring inflation is contained, revenues are mobilised efficiently, and credit flows effectively to productive sectors.

In a statement, Mohammed Manga, Director, Information and Public Relations, said, as the Nigerian economy continues to navigate complex global and domestic challenges, this meeting sends a strong signal of the government’s determination to work towards a more stable and prosperous economic future for all Nigerians.

With coordinated policy efforts and a shared vision for economic growth, Nigeria is poised to unlock new opportunities for development and prosperity.
